How to take Levofloxacin tablets

Levofloxacin tablets are a commonly used antibiotic that belongs to the quinolone class. It is mainly used to treat infections caused by sensitive bacteria, such as respiratory tract infections, urinary tract infections, skin and soft tissue infections, etc. Correct use of levofloxacin tablets is crucial for therapeutic effect. The following is a detailed description of the usage, dosage and precautions of levofloxacin tablets.

1. Basic information about Levofloxacin tablets

How to take Levofloxacin tablets

The main component of Levofloxacin tablets is Levofloxacin. Its pharmacological effect is to inhibit the activity of bacterial DNA gyrase and prevent bacterial DNA replication, thereby achieving a bactericidal effect. The following is basic information about Levofloxacin tablets:

projectcontent
Drug nameLevofloxacin tablets
English nameLevofloxacin Tablets
Main ingredientsLevofloxacin
IndicationsRespiratory tract infections, urinary tract infections, skin and soft tissue infections, etc.
Dosage formtablet
SpecificationCommon specifications are 0.25g, 0.5g

2. Usage and dosage of Levofloxacin Tablets

The usage and dosage of Levofloxacin tablets need to be adjusted according to the patient's age, condition and doctor's recommendations. The following are common uses and dosages:

IndicationsUsage and dosageCourse of treatment
respiratory tract infection0.5g once, once a day7-14 days
urinary tract infection0.25g once, once a day3-7 days
Skin and soft tissue infections0.5g once, once a day7-10 days
complicated urinary tract infection0.5g once, once a day10-14 days

3. Precautions when taking Levofloxacin Tablets

1.Medication time:Levofloxacin tablets should be taken 1 hour before or 2 hours after meals to avoid taking them with food, which may affect absorption.

2.Drinking water requirements:You should drink plenty of water when taking the medicine to avoid excessive concentration of the medicine in the urine and the formation of crystals.

3.Taboo groups:It is prohibited for those allergic to quinolones, pregnant women, lactating women and adolescents under 18 years old.

4.Adverse reactions:Common adverse reactions include nausea, diarrhea, headache, etc. In severe cases, allergic reactions or tendonitis may occur.

5.Drug interactions:Avoid taking antacids containing aluminum and magnesium at the same time, and the interval should be more than 2 hours; when combined with theophylline drugs, blood drug concentration should be monitored.

4. Storage method of Levofloxacin tablets

Levofloxacin tablets should be stored in a cool, dry place away from direct sunlight and out of reach of children. After opening, it must be sealed and stored to prevent moisture.
